Stress Reduction Through Nutrition: How to Support Your Hormonal Balance

Imagine your hormone system as an orchestra: When cortisol, insulin, and serotonin play in harmony, focus, energy, and calmness emerge. If just one instrument goes out of tune, everything feels nervous and rushed. The good news: Your daily nutrition is the conductor’s baton. With a few wise choices, you can bring your hormonal orchestra back into harmony – noticeably in your mind, your gut, and your blood pressure.

Stress hormones like cortisol temporarily ensure performance, but chronically elevated cortisol disrupts sleep, the immune system, and metabolism. The HPA axis controls this response. At the same time, the gut-brain axis shapes our emotional state: About 90% of serotonin is produced in the gut – influenced by micronutrients, fatty acids, and the microbiota. Nutrients act as regulators: omega-3 fatty acids dampen stress reactions; magnesium and B vitamins keep the stress brake active. Too much sodium, saturated and trans fats, or long fasting periods drive blood sugar and cortisol fluctuations. The goal is balance: stable energy throughout the day, an anti-inflammatory diet, and a gut environment that promotes serotonin and calmness.

A high intake of saturated and trans fatty acids alters hormonal controls and promotes stress hormones; they also impair insulin sensitivity, which increases metabolic stress [1]. Long fasting intervals without structure destabilize blood sugar and alter hormonal signals like leptin and cortisol – this can enhance reactivity to stress and disrupt the circadian rhythm [2]. A deficiency in magnesium increases the excitability of the HPA axis; preclinical and initial clinical evidence shows: magnesium deficiency increases anxiety-like behavior and ACTH/corticotropin signals – a biological fingerprint of "chronic stress" [3]. Too much salt raises blood pressure and intensifies cardiovascular stress reactivity; salt-sensitive individuals show stronger heart rate increases, reduced heart rate variability, and higher cortisol levels under mental stress – a risky pattern for high performers [Ref18337758; Ref34579054; Ref40995136]. Conversely, omega-3 fatty acids support stress tolerance and mood, especially under higher psychological strain [Ref25732379; Ref41461240]. Probiotics modulate the gut-brain axis and influence serotonin pathways, with measurable improvements in stress, sleep, and cognition – depending on strain, dosage, and baseline load [Ref41304221; Ref41971341]. Vitamin D interacts with receptors in the brain linked to serotonin synthesis and can improve mood and stress processing [4].

Several randomized studies illuminate the impact of omega-3 on stress. In young, healthy adults, a 35-day, double-blind supplementation with fish oil under acute stress induction showed minimal effects on cortisol and cognition, but it prevented the stress increase from anger and confusion compared to placebo – an indication of emotional buffering under stress [5]. In another double-blind study with highly stressed adults, moderate EPA/DHA doses over three months significantly improved stress, anxiety, depression, sleep quality, and everyday memory – typical for populations with high baseline stress that benefit more [6]. The role of the microbiome is supported by preclinical and clinical work: Kefir increased serotonin biosynthesis in the gut and brain in an animal model and reduced degradation – a mechanistic window into gut-brain communication [7]. Clinical reviews also show strain- and context-dependent effects of psychobiotics on stress resilience and mood, particularly under higher baseline stress and appropriate dosing [8]. On the risk side, human and review studies clarify that high sodium intake causally increases blood pressure and exacerbates stress reactivity; new data even link salt to immune-mediated inflammation, affecting blood vessels and kidneys – an additional stress amplifier for the system [Ref18337758; Ref34579054; Ref40995136]. Finally, preclinical data show that magnesium deficiency upregulates the HPA axis and triggers anxiety behavior – biologically plausible and clinically relevant in marginal nutrient supply [3].

- Intentionally include omega-3: Two to three times per week fatty fish (e.g., salmon, mackerel, herring) or daily 1–2 tablespoons of ground flaxseeds/chia seeds. Alternatively, 1–2 grams of EPA/DHA per day after consulting a doctor, especially under high psychological stress [5] [6].
- Probiotics for the gut-brain axis: Daily 150–200 grams of natural yogurt or 1 glass of kefir. Look for live cultures; vary strains across products. Supplement with prebiotic fibers (e.g., oats, vegetables) to support serotonin pathways [7] [8].
- Ensure vitamin D: 2–3 times per week fatty fish, plus eggs and fortified foods. Check your 25-OH vitamin D level if in doubt and supplement strategically to support serotonergic systems [4].
- Anti-inflammatory spices: Daily turmeric (with black pepper for better bioavailability) and ginger in cooking or tea. Note: If trying to conceive, pregnant, or have hormonal disorders, critically assess high-dosage turmeric and consult a doctor [9].
- Stabilize blood sugar: Structured meals (3 main meals or 2 mains plus 1–2 snacks) within an 8–12 hour daily window; include protein and fiber with every meal to avoid cortisol spikes from hypoglycemia [2].
- Choose fats wisely: Reduce saturated fats and trans fats (fried snacks, baked goods with hydrogenated fats). Instead, opt for olive oil, nuts, seeds – beneficial for hormonal signals and insulin sensitivity [1].
- Consciously reduce salt: Cook fresh, season with herbs/lemon instead of salt, and choose unprocessed foods. Aim for <5 grams of salt/day, especially with family history of hypertension or high stress [10] [11] [12].

Stress resilience starts on your plate: Stable blood sugar, omega-3, vitamin D, and a vibrant gut lower cortisol peaks and promote calmness in the mind. Start this week with two fish meals, daily fermented foods, and a salt checklist in the kitchen – small steps, great hormonal impact.
